> Has anyone tried one of those machines?

Yes. It wouldn't boot when I got it. I tried to get it sorted and eventually
it was evident it wasn't going to work and I sent it back. They then decided
they weren't going to give a full refund. They got *really* quite arsey
about it when I started escalating the bad debt and tried to intimidate me
into backing down. Which just rubbed me up the wrong way and ensured I would
finish what I started.

To cut a long story short, about 2-3 months later, the Eyetech MD and myself
walked out of Bradford County Court, him with face like thunder and me
smirking slightly, with a judgement in my favour.

I cannot recommend dealing with Eyetech nor getting one of those boards.

Besides, a Mac Mini will wipe the floor with an Eyetech system and cost
less. It'll run AmigaOS about as well as the AmigaOne: with UAE to emulate
the legacy m68k systems and a dream that it'll run native one day.
